Player of the year at 69 is a real keeper

- BY ADAM ASPINALL

A GOALIE grandad has won “player of the league” at the age of 69.

Robert Norfolk beat contenders half his age to take the title after his sixa-side team came top in their Sunday league.

The keeper, of Bridgend, South Wales, said: “I keep playing purely for enjoyment. It’s about the sport, but we like it when we win.

“It’s purely for the love of playing – you have to have that.” He plays in the league alongside his three sons and his nephew.

Son Darren, 44, said: “He’s still very brave and very agile. He’s still a very, very good goalie and he’s an absolute gentleman.

“We’re all absolutely football mad and we all support West Brom.”
